What Are Cookies?
Cookies are small text files placed on your device by your web browser when you visit a website. They're widely used to make websites work, remember preferences between visits, and provide information to site owners. Cookies set by the site you're visiting are called first-party cookies; cookies set by domains other than the site you're visiting are called third-party cookies.
We also use similar technologies such as local storage, which stores information directly in your browser the same way a cookie does, but with a different storage mechanism.
